    Civilization 2 runs fine in Windows 3.1. Most people who are having problems running it are trying to run the version that was modified to run in modern Windows, but the original release works fine (patched up to 2.42, which was the last patch). I don’t know if the Gold or Test of Time releases work, though.

    Tested Dark Forces 2 on win 95 on my s7 edge… too slow to play (5-8 fps ) but gog version works “out of the box”.

    Edit: setting win 95 to 640×480 8 bit color and pumping mdb to 150000 cycles makes the game somewhat playable (in the 30s fps ) but turs the phone into a toaster.
